MeshCore::MeshSegmentAlgorithm Class Reference
#include <Segmentation.h>
Public Member Functions | |
void | FindSegments (std::vector< MeshSurfaceSegmentPtr > &) |
MeshSegmentAlgorithm (const MeshKernel &kernel) | |
Constructor & Destructor Documentation
◆ MeshSegmentAlgorithm()
MeshCore::MeshSegmentAlgorithm::MeshSegmentAlgorithm | ( | const MeshKernel & | kernel | ) |
Member Function Documentation
◆ FindSegments()
void MeshSegmentAlgorithm::FindSegments | ( | std::vector< MeshSurfaceSegmentPtr > & | segm | ) |
References MeshCore::MeshAlgorithm::CountFacetFlag(), MeshCore::MeshKernel::GetFacets(), MeshCore::MeshAlgorithm::ResetFacetFlag(), MeshCore::MeshAlgorithm::ResetFacetsFlag(), MeshCore::MeshFacet::VISIT, and MeshCore::MeshKernel::VisitNeighbourFacets().
Referenced by MeshGui::Segmentation::accept(), ReverseEngineeringGui::Segmentation::accept(), MeshGui::SegmentationBestFit::accept(), ReverseEngineeringGui::SegmentationManual::Private::findGeometry(), Mesh::MeshPy::getSegmentsByCurvature(), and Mesh::MeshObject::getSegmentsOfType().
The documentation for this class was generated from the following files:
- src/Mod/Mesh/App/Core/Segmentation.h
- src/Mod/Mesh/App/Core/Segmentation.cpp